系统文档是用于描述、记录和解释一个系统或程序的详细文档。它通常包括系统设计、实现、操作和维护的所有相关信息,以便用户、开发者和其他相关人员能够理解和使用该系统。
定义:
系统文档是一种详细的技术文档,用于描述一个系统或程序的功能、结构、接口、数据、算法等。它可以帮助用户、开发者和其他相关人员快速了解和使用系统,提高开发效率和系统质量。
用途:
1. 提供系统功能和操作指南:系统文档详细描述了系统的功能和操作步骤,使得用户可以按照文档中的说明进行操作,避免错误和遗漏。
2. 辅助系统设计和开发:系统文档可以作为系统设计和开发的参考,帮助开发人员更好地理解需求,优化系统设计和实现。
3. 便于维护和管理:系统文档包含了系统的基本信息和配置要求,使得维护人员能够快速定位问题并进行修复,提高系统的稳定性和可用性。
4. 支持系统升级和扩展:系统文档中包含了系统的架构和技术规范,使得在系统升级或扩展时,维护人员能够更好地理解和实施新的需求和功能。
常见类型:
1. 设计文档:设计文档主要包括系统设计图、数据库设计、界面设计等,描述了系统的结构和功能,为开发人员提供了明确的指导。
2. 代码文档:代码文档主要包括源代码注释、API文档、单元测试等,描述了系统的实现细节,为开发人员提供了参考。
3. 部署文档:部署文档主要包括系统部署手册、环境配置说明等,描述了系统的运行环境和配置要求,为系统管理员提供了指导。
4. 操作手册:操作手册主要包括系统使用指南、常见问题解答等,描述了系统的使用方法和注意事项,为用户提供了方便。
5. 培训资料:培训资料主要包括系统培训课件、教学视频等,为培训人员提供了学习资源,帮助他们掌握系统的操作和使用方法。